What You’ll Do

This role is focused on building engaging, polished gameplay systems for an action-RPG title. You will join a cross-functional team and contribute to production-quality gameplay features from design through implementation and tuning.

  • Design, implement, maintain, and iterate gameplay systems (abilities, combat, interactions, quests, UI hooks, etc.)
  • Integrate systems with designers, artists, and tools teams to create a high-quality player experience
  • Debug and optimize gameplay code for performance and stability
  • Contribute to internal tools and pipelines that improve team productivity
  • Communicate technical trade-offs clearly and collaborate to reach decisions that favor gameplay first

What We’re Looking For (Minimum Requirements)

  • 2+ years professional software engineering experience (industry or equivalent academic projects)
  • Strong proficiency in C++ (or comparable systems language) and solid object-oriented programming fundamentals
  • Understanding of design patterns and systems architecture
  • Strong problem-solving skills and attention to performance and stability
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ills for cross-discipline collaboration
  • Comfortable working in a hybrid team environment (mix of remote and on-site days)

Nice-to-Haves / Bonus Points

  • Experience working on ARPGs, RPGs, or other action-oriented game genres
  • Prior work on gameplay systems such as combat, AI/pathfinding, quests, scripting, or narrative tools
  • Experience building or supporting developer tools and pipelines
  • Familiarity with C# or scripting languages used in game engines
  • Experience contributing in cross-functional teams with designers and artists
